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method and device for designing skins

A design method and skin technology, applied in the computer field, can solve problems such as increased maintenance difficulty and inconsistent element styles, and achieve the effect of unification and diversification and simplified resource management

Active Publication Date: 2011-11-09
TENCENT TECH (SHENZHEN) CO LTD
View PDF2 Cites 14 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, in the process of using XML, in order to refer to a certain type of skin elements with the same characteristics in the skin system, a large number of repetitive sentences are used for description, resulting in the writing of a large number of repetitive sentences in the skin editing document, and some elements on the interface There will be inconsistencies in the style of the system, and there are a lot of defects in the unified management of resources. Even a small change needs to modify a lot of XML
When the resources that need to be maintained by the software interface are very large, the difficulty of maintenance increases exponentially

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and device for designing skins
  • Method and device for designing skins
  • Method and device for designing skins

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0039] In the technical solution provided by the present invention, the core idea is to classify and abstract a large number of elements that appear in the skin system, and introduce fragment elements (Fragment Element) into the skin system. For representing different skin control objects, the abstraction becomes various types of fragment elements, such as: button, dialog title bar, dialog bottom bar, radio box, combo box, edit box, slide bar and list, etc. The introduction of fragment elements makes the skin system only need to maintain a prototype, and different effects can be presented by configuring parameters during use. As long as simple editing operations are used, the interface can be unified and diversified; the uniqueness of the prototype makes Resource management is greatly simplified and duplication of XML descriptions is avoided. In addition, when parsing the skin configuration document of a fragment element, the preprocessing technology can also be used to pre-tr...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a method for designing skins. The method comprises the following steps: analyzing fragment elements in a target skin file and configuration parameters corresponding to the fragment elements and mapping the target skin file into the corresponding control class to generate a control object corresponding to the target skin file; and drawing the skin of a user interface and presenting the control object on the skin of the user interface. The method has the following advantages: the fragment elements are introduced into a skin system and different skin effects can be presented by configuring the parameters for the fragment elements, thus realizing the unification and diversification of the interface and simplifying the resource management. The invention also discloses a device applying the method.

Description

technical field [0001] The invention relates to the field of computer technology, in particular to a skin design method and device. Background technique [0002] With the improvement of computer processing capabilities and the continuous development of interactive interfaces, in the Internet era with rapid information development and changing user needs, and under the premise of emphasizing rich experience, more and more software put user experience as a very important high. While the software functions are enriched, the image elements and configuration information corresponding to the interface development part are increasing exponentially, and more and more software uses customizable skins to improve the interactive experience of products. The skin system usually includes a series of image files and related configuration information, and the application program presents the user interface through the above image files and configuration information to achieve rich experien...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F9/44G06T11/60G06F17/30
Inventor 吴运声邹灵灵
Owner TENCENT TECH (SHENZHEN) C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products